Anyone,

        We've recently installed a clear channel DS3 between offices using
Adtran T3SU 300s and 3662 routers with HSSI. We're only getting about half
a meg of throughput. We're using all timeslots and not getting errors. It
was setup with PPP encapsulation. Is there any problem with running PPP
over a T3? Also, using PPP forced it into doing fair queuing, which I know
Cisco doesn't recommend for anything over E1 speed. Should I give HDLC a
try, or is there something else I should look at first? This is my first
experience with a T3, so I'm a little unfamiliar with the 'sh controller'
output.
